Design and Development for Engineering and Manufacturing T Level results 2026

1,649 students took the Design and Development for Engineering and Manufacturing T Level this year, up 48% on last year. 81.6% achieved a pass or above and 10.4% a distinction or above.

Provisional Department for Education figures, published 13 August 2026. England only. First awarded in 2024.

Every year in numbers

YearStudentsD*D+M+Pass+
20261,6490%10.4%43.4%81.6%provisional
20251,1140%8.9%44.9%82.4%revised
20245550%7%38.9%75%

UCAS points

A Distinction* is worth 168 UCAS points, the same as three A-level A*s. A Distinction is 144 (AAA), a Merit 120 (BBB), and a Pass 96 or 72 depending on the core-component grade. Full table on the T Level results page.
